Jace Wilson is the oldest boy of Bradley and Hazel Wilson. He has two brothers, Dallas and Braydon. Jace forged a friendship with Julia O'Neill when they were kids. They dealt with the growing pains of their friendship as they grew older. 

When Jace left for college on a baseball scholarship, Julia figured he would forget about her and find the great love of his life. Jace had returned home on school breaks but kept missing Julia, but he never forgot his friendship with the girl next door. 

When Jace comes home after graduating college, he returns to find Julia isn't the same girl he grew up with next door. His heart also remembers the long term friendship as Jace's feelings turn into something more. 

Will Julia quit denying what everyone has been telling her about Jace? Or will she remain as the queen of denial?
